Authorization Check on Radio Button

Hi,
I have a custom report which has a radio button. Can I provide the authorization on this radio button, meaning only selected no. of users can run this report with radio button checked. I know it's possible through maintaining a list of users in custom table, But I want to check if we can do it using authorization object/group etc...

Birendra, you're absolutely correct that we need to consider future maintenance efforts. But this is exactly a weak side of the parameter approach that you've suggested. The jet analogy is impressive, but way out of proportion in this case.
Using authority check command in ABAP code and modifying screen elements is not hard-coding. The parameter approach also requires writing some code, so it has no advantage here.
Also it requires someone (a Basis admin?) to update the user profile and a table entry that you've mentioned. To use the standard authorizations, only one authorization object will need to be created (although it may even be possible to use another, existing object if it's the same authorization level). It won't take more space or more time to create than an SM30 entry. Updating the roles might be more of a hassle than updating the user parameter, but the difference can hardly be considered significant and it's a one-time thing anyway.
It is a matter of preference whether to hide a control, disable it or display a message. (By the way, in many standard transactions you'll find that controls or menu options are hidden/disabled based on authorization, so it is nothing exotic.) But I stand by my suggestion of using standard authorization check functionality specifically because it makes the future maintenance easier.
1) Basis admins most likely already maintain some document regarding the role assignment. It might be actually easier to them to maintain the roles than to keep track of the additional profile parameter and remember it in future.
2) Imagine years from now you're gone and all the new people are maintaining the system. The user gets a 'no authorization' message and, naturally, contacts a system admin. Again, naturally, admin will check security trace. Now guess what - your parameter thingy cannot be tracked anywhere. No one knows about it and it will take an ABAPer to figure this out.
With standard approach it will only take a second to run SU53 and a few minutes to resolve an issue by a Basis admin. Additionally, authorization objects have 'where used' button, so it would be easy to check if and where the object is used (e.g. if the report has been changed/deleted it will be easy to spot the 'orphaned' object). With the profile parameter sooner or later someone will have to wonder what the heck it is for and might accidentally delete it. By the way, sometimes users actually have access to their own parameters, so it's not a very secure option either.

  • Check Box or  Drow Radio Button on Bex Query

    Hi Experts,
    Does anyone know to how to put a "Check Box" or  "Drow Radio Button" variable on query selection screen?
    The user want to switch the order data between open and completed on a same report by a check box / radio button.
    Thnaks

    Hi Linkzhou,
    Why don't you directly use a var on Actual Delivery Date & include/exclude on # cases to report open/closed shipments.
    Alternatively, You can achieve the same without making changes to backend, if you are ok with using WAD. In WAD 7, you can use a DropDown webitem instead of a RadioButton/Checkbox webitem since you cannot assign a Command on selection from a RadioButton/Checkbox webitem. Also, you would need to design the same in a web template since this will not be made available on your query selection screen.
    In the DropDown webitem, use Data Binding Type -> 'Fixed List of Options' , here you can configure
    Open -> under Action use Command 'SET_SELECTION_STATE_SIMPLE', choose your Actual Delivery Date char, Sign -> INCLUDING, Operator -> Equals, Equals -> Member Name, Member Name -> Direct Input -> # [Not Assigned]
    Closed -> under Action use Command 'SET_SELECTION_STATE_SIMPLE', choose your Actual Delivery Date char, Sign -> EXCLUDING, Operator -> Equals, Equals -> Member Name, Member Name -> Direct Input -> # [Not Assigned]
    Now when the user selects Open option from the DropDown webitem, the data provider query will be filtered for open shipments & vice versa for Closed option.

  • Using radio button to go to marker

    Hi,
    I'm using Director Mx for Windows. When the user checks a
    radio button (cast member "bon"), I want the movie to jump to a
    certain marker ("start"). I'm currently using the script below,
    (which uses the hilite property) that I thought would solve the
    problem, but nothing happened when I tried it.
    on mouseUp me
    if member("bon").hilite = TRUE then go to "start"
    end if
    end
    Does anyone have any idea of what might work? Thanks so
    much.

    > on mouseUp me
    > if member("bon").hilite = TRUE then go to "start"
    > end if
    > end
    Your code should work, though half of what's there is
    unnecessary.
    Simplification:
    on mouseUp
    if member("bon").hilite then go "start"
    end
    That extra "end if" won't cause problems here, but in more
    complex scripts
    it can really get you in trouble. You only need that if
    you're doing more
    than one command within the "if" or "else" if there is one.
    You can
    generally tell if something like that is extra by the fact
    that the
    auto-indentation is off. Every "end if" should be at the same
    indentation
    as its matching "if". If it isn't, then something is wrong.
    As for the other changes, the "me" is only necessary if
    you're actually
    going to use it in the script. Leaving it in is harmless, but
    just extra.
    The "= TRUE" is unnecessary in most cases, because saying "if
    A" is exactly
    the same as saying "if A = TRUE". And the word "to" is never
    needed in a
    "go" statement. (These are optional changes that won't cause
    or fix any
    problems, but saves a bunch of extra typing.)

  • How to uncheck all radio buttons in WHEN-NEW-FORM-INSTANCE trigger

    Hi,
    I have one radio group(RDBTNGRP) having three radio buttons (RDBTN1,RDBTN2,RDBTN3) in a control block, i want to uncheck all these three buttons through code.
    Any help please.
    Regards,

    Hello,
    I don't think you can achieve using the code or property to unselect all radio buttons.
    One possibility is there to create one extra radio button in that same group and set any value for that. Let say you have two radio buttons in the radio group and now you created one more radio button in the same group. And set the value like ABC. Now go to the property of new created radio button and set the X Position, Y Position, Width and Height to zero (0). And set the initial value for that radio group to ABC (new created radio button). So at runtime it will look like unselected all radio buttons. And while saving you can check if radio button selected on your criteria or not.
